What Is Cold Laser Therapy?



Cold laser treatment, also called low-level laser therapy (LLLT), is a non-invasive treatment that uses details wavelengths of light to promote healing and lower discomfort.

This ingenious approach targets damaged tissues, boosting cellular task without triggering injury or discomfort. You might discover it beneficial for different problems, consisting of joint pain, muscle injuries, and inflammation.

Unlike traditional laser treatments, cold laser therapy does not produce heat, making it risk-free and comfy for clients. Therapies usually last in between 5 to thirty minutes, depending on the location being resolved.

You may receive numerous sessions for optimum results, and many individuals report feeling relief after just a few therapies.

Cold laser therapy offers an appealing choice for those seeking efficient discomfort management.

Mechanism of Action



Laser treatment uses low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ate cellular procedures. When you receive treatment, the light permeates your skin and is taken in by your cells, especially the mitochondria. This absorption enhances ATP production, which is the power currency of your cells. Consequently, your cells can repair themselves more quickly and efficiently.

Additionally, cold laser therapy promotes enhanced blood flow, delivering more oxygen and nutrients to broken cells. It additionally helps in reducing inflammation and discomfort by modulating the release of different biochemical substances.

Session Period and Regularity



Many cold laser treatment sessions last between 15 to half an hour, depending upon the specific therapy area and your private requirements.

Throughout your session, the therapist will certainly position the laser device over the targeted area, allowing it to emit light that permeates the skin.

You might need several sessions for ideal outcomes, commonly ranging from 2 to 3 times weekly.

Your doctor will customize the regularity based on your condition and response to treatment.

It's essential to follow their recommendations for the very best end result.

Remember that consistency is vital, so attempt to adhere to the routine your therapist suggests to make the most of the benefits of cold laser treatment.

Security and Side Effects of Cold Laser Therapy



While cold laser therapy is typically taken into consideration secure, it's necessary to understand possible negative effects. Most people experience very little pain, but you may discover short-term skin irritation or a sensation of warmth throughout treatment.

Seldom, some individuals report headaches or wooziness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have specific medical problems, review this with your doctor prior to starting treatment.

Additionally, guarantee the expert is certified and utilizes FDA-approved equipment. Although significant adverse effects are uncommon, it's a good idea to monitor your body's action after each session.

If you experience any kind of uncommon signs and symptoms, don't hesitate to connect to your doctor for assistance. Being educated aids guarantee a positive experience with cold laser treatment.
